«Breaking News» Rudy Giuliani claims he is staying off TV because Mueller report is 'imminent'

Rudy Giuliani, a personal attorney to President Donald Trump, claims he has not been on television in almost two months because he thought special counsel Robert Mueller's report was 'imminent' and not because the president was upset with his repeated gaffes. 


'About a month to a month and a half ago we decided, because we thought the Mueller report was imminent in the next four or five days, that it would be better not to comment until the report was filed or made public,' Giuliani told Axios of his absence on various news programs.


'Obviously those days have now expanded way beyond four or five days,' he added.

The former Mayor of New York City is one of the president's most prominent public defenders.


He was last seen on television defending the president on Sunday, January 20th, when he appeared on NBC's 'Meet the Press' and CNN's 'State of the Union.'


He did make a short appearance on March 8 hit on the streaming channel of The Hill newspaper. 


But it was his unimpressive performance on the January 20th Sunday show circuit that enraged Trump allies and officials within the administration.


DailyMail.com reported at the time that Giuliani's media blitz, which was filled with a dizzying array of misstatements and hurried clarifications, agitated President Trump and some of his allies, who then raised the possibility that the outspoken presidential lawyer should be sidelined from televised interviews – at least temporarily.


'Every time he opens his mouth on TV it's like 'Cleanup on aisle Giuliani!'' a White House official told DailyMail.com on Wednesday.  

Giuliani told Axios has spent hours with the president in the last month and hasn't heard any complaints about his TV appearances from him.


A former federal prosecutor, Giuliani has been the point person on defending the president from any allegations tied to the Russian investigation into the 2016 election and to undermine anything that may come out of the special counsel's investigation.  


But, in his Jan. 20 'Meet the Press' appearance, Giuliani dramatically altered the timeline regarding discussions about a Trump Tower in Moscow, now asserting they stretched until November 2016.

That statement, which suggested that the Trump Organization was engaged in business dealings with Russia up to and beyond the election, ignited a firestorm and then an abrupt walk-back from Giuliani. 


He issued a statement the next day saying his comments about the project 'were hypothetical and not based on conversations I had with the President. My comments did not represent the actual timing or circumstances of any such discussions.'


Reports at the time indicated the president was angry with Giuliani for the goof and that some aides were worried the former mayor was going on television after drinking.


Giuliani has previously insisted he does not have an issue with alcohol, denying to Politico last May that it affected his interviews. He added: 'I may have a drink for dinner. I like to drink with cigars.'
